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Upper Arlington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Upper Arlington with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Upper Arlington is at Lexington Park listed at $985.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Upper Arlington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Upper Arlington is $2,034.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Upper Arlington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Upper Arlington is a 1,780 square feet unit starting from $1,778 at The Commons At Olentangy.

What is the average size for Upper Arlington 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Upper Arlington is currently 1,170 sq ft.
